// Copyright (c) 2007-2009 Nokia Corporation and/or its subsidiary(-ies).
// All rights reserved.
// This component and the accompanying materials are made available
// under the terms of the License "Eclipse Public License v1.0"
// which accompanies this distribution, and is available
// at the URL "http://www.eclipse.org/legal/epl-v10.html".
//
// Initial Contributors:
// Nokia Corporation - initial contribution.
//
// Contributors:
//
// Description:
//
TARGET t_usbdi.exe
TARGETTYPE exe
CAPABILITY WriteDeviceData CommDD PowerMgmt // Direct access to all communications equipment device drivers
UID 0 0x10282b48 // Uid2 ignored
//MACRO GENERATE_TREES
// uncomment this line to save trees in files(ref. trees)
// Header file paths
OS_LAYER_SYSTEMINCLUDE_SYMBIAN
USERINCLUDE ../inc
// Source file paths
SOURCEPATH ../src
// The test executable
SOURCE main.cpp
// Engine and controller
SOURCE testengine.cpp
SOURCE testcasecontroller.cpp
SOURCE testpolicy.cpp
SOURCE usbdescriptoroffsets.cpp
SOURCE fdfactor.cpp
// Test factory
SOURCE testcasefactory.cpp
// Timers/Watchers
SOURCE usbclientstatewatcher.cpp
SOURCE basicwatcher.cpp
SOURCE softwareconnecttimer.cpp
SOURCE wakeuptimer.cpp
// Modelled test devices
SOURCE testdevicebase.cpp
SOURCE testinterfacebase.cpp
SOURCE testinterfacesettingbase.cpp
SOURCE vendordevice.cpp
SOURCE testdeviceA.cpp
SOURCE testdeviceB.cpp
SOURCE testdeviceC.cpp
SOURCE testdeviceD.cpp
SOURCE endpointreader.cpp
SOURCE endpointwriter.cpp
SOURCE controlendpointreader.cpp
// Transfers
SOURCE controltransferrequests.cpp
SOURCE hostinterrupttransfers.cpp
SOURCE hostisochronoustransfers.cpp
SOURCE hostbulktransfers.cpp
SOURCE Ep0Reader.cpp
SOURCE BaseTestCase.cpp
SOURCE BaseBulkTestCase.cpp
SOURCE PBASE-T_USBDI-0472.cpp
SOURCE PBASE-T_USBDI-0473.cpp
SOURCE PBASE-T_USBDI-0474.cpp
SOURCE PBASE-T_USBDI-0475.cpp
SOURCE PBASE-T_USBDI-0476.cpp
SOURCE PBASE-T_USBDI-0477.cpp
SOURCE PBASE-T_USBDI-0478.cpp
SOURCE PBASE-T_USBDI-0479.cpp
SOURCE PBASE-T_USBDI-0480.cpp
SOURCE PBASE-T_USBDI-0481.cpp
SOURCE PBASE-T_USBDI-0482.cpp
SOURCE PBASE-T_USBDI-0483.cpp
SOURCE PBASE-T_USBDI-0484.cpp
SOURCE PBASE-T_USBDI-0485.cpp
SOURCE PBASE-T_USBDI-0486.cpp
SOURCE PBASE-T_USBDI-0487.cpp
SOURCE PBASE-T_USBDI-0488.cpp
SOURCE PBASE-T_USBDI-0489.cpp
SOURCE PBASE-T_USBDI-0490.cpp
SOURCE PBASE-T_USBDI-0491.cpp
SOURCE PBASE-T_USBDI-0492.cpp
SOURCE PBASE-T_USBDI-0493.cpp
SOURCE PBASE-T_USBDI-0494.cpp
SOURCE PBASE-T_USBDI-0495.cpp
SOURCE PBASE-T_USBDI-0496.cpp
SOURCE PBASE-T_USBDI-0497.cpp
SOURCE PBASE-T_USBDI-0498.cpp
SOURCE PBASE-T_USBDI-0499.cpp
SOURCE PBASE-T_USBDI-0500.cpp
SOURCE PBASE-T_USBDI-1229.cpp
SOURCE PBASE-T_USBDI-1230.cpp
SOURCE PBASE-T_USBDI-1231.cpp
SOURCE PBASE-T_USBDI-1234.cpp
SOURCE PBASE-T_USBDI-1235.cpp
SOURCE PBASE-T_USBDI-1236.cpp
// The test cases
// Link Libraries
LIBRARY euser.lib efsrv.lib
LIBRARY usbdescriptors.lib usbdi_utils.lib
VENDORID 0x70000001
SMPSAFE